MAGAZINES - The Daily Telegraph - 02 December, 2022
US $7.73
691548
691548
The Daily Telegraph - 02 December, 2022
Author: The Daily Telegraph
Format: PDF
Format: PDF
The Daily Telegraph, daily newspaper published in London, UK.